What causes phone fps drop?

Games Are demanding. Multi-tasking can cause dropped frames. When we clear all tasks from the multitasking column then we clear some amount of ram which can then be used to give more power to the game so that it can run a bit smoother. This problem with multi-tasking or less ram mainly occurs with 1GB ram phones.

What is force 4 * MSAA?

Short Bytes: By activating Force 4x MSAA setting in Android Developer Options, you can enjoy a better gaming performance. It forces your phone to use 4x multisample anti-aliasing in OpenGL 2.0 games and apps. However, enabling this setting can drain your smartphone’s battery faster.

Are there any apps to improve gaming on Android?

On Android, you can find several apps to tweak low-level system settings, freeing up system resources to leave more headroom for your games. There’s no similar set of tools available on iOS however, as apps don’t have the same deep access to the operating system as they do on Android. Game Booster is a favorite.
